Champion, Paul
Champion's stereoviews were published by Charles Gaudin; B.K. Editeur. Paris[A. Block] as Chine & Japon; Asiatic Views. China; and the Vue De Chine series which appears to be the only numbered set.This view is from the last-named series. Judging by the numbers we have seen, the series consisted of some 100 views.CHAMPION, Paul (1838-1884) was a gifted amateur French photographer who travelled to China and Japan in 1865-1866 on behalf of the Societe zoologique d'Acclimatation. He brought back zoological specimens and many fine large-format and stereoview photographs of several regions in China. His views of Peking are some of the earliest to be published. Champion had to overcome considerable technical difficulties in securing his views, and the photograph here, although otherwise in good condition, shows some slight defects in the negative.
